President Donald Trump has selected White House policy aide Heidi Overton to lead the Food and Drug Administration following a turbulent year of staff exits and industry complaints. Overton, a medical doctor with a PhD from Johns Hopkins University, has led White House health policy during Trump's second term, overseeing vaccine schedules and food pyramid overhauls. Her nomination, which requires Senate confirmation, comes after Trump interviewed candidates including oncologist Jeff Vacirca.
